gml.noaa.govability to control temperature. The condition of the body's temperature is the information fed back to the brain, which is the controller. If the temperature is high, the body sweats in order to cool down. Since the process of sweating is done to stop the temperature change, this is a negative feedback.

TEACHER BACKGROUND: SPECIFICS OF HEAT TRANSFER
gml.noaa.govIn a new scenario, a metal can containing hot water is placed in a Styrofoam cup containing cold water. Heat is transferred from the hot water to the cold water until both samples have the same temperature. The transfer of heat from the hot water through the metal can to the cold water is referred to as conduction.
